Blossoms and Blue Waters: Discover the Hidden Gem of Blue Hole

Discover the enchanting Blue Hole in Santa Rosa, New Mexico—a hidden gem for nature lovers and adventure seekers alike. This stunning natural swimming hole boasts crystal-clear, spring-fed waters perfect for diving, snorkeling, and simply soaking in the serene surroundings. Nestled in the charming small town of Santa Rosa, visitors can explore nearby attractions like the Route 66 Auto Museum and the captivating Blue Hole Dive Shop. With its vibrant wildflowers and picturesque landscapes, Blue Hole offers a refreshing escape that combines outdoor excitement with the warmth of small-town charm.   • St. Rose of Lima Catholic ChurchOpens in a new window – Visit this charming church, a beautiful example of small-town architecture. Surrounded by colorful flowers, it offers a peaceful spot for reflection and appreciation of local history.
  • Route 66 Auto MuseumOpens in a new window – Step into the world of classic cars at the Route 66 Auto Museum. This transport museum showcases a unique collection of vehicles that tell the story of the iconic highway and its impact on American culture. It's a delightful stop for both car enthusiasts and casual visitors alike.
  • Santa Rosa Lake State ParkOpens in a new window – Spend a day outdoors at Santa Rosa Lake State Park, where you can enjoy fishing, boating, and hiking amid stunning natural landscapes. The park's serene environment and lovely floral surroundings make it a perfect getaway to connect with nature.
  • Sumner Lake State ParkOpens in a new window – Another gem for outdoor lovers, Sumner Lake State Park offers ample opportunities for water activities like kayaking and swimming. Explore the trails or set up a picnic while taking in the vibrant beauty of the local flora.

Best time to go to Blue Hole

Blue Hole experiences its lowest average temperature in January, at 39.2°F (4.0°C), while July is the hottest month, with an average temperature of 80.8°F (27.1°C). July is typically the wettest month.
